Flowers have a way of turning any frown upside down but aside from brightening a mood, flowers also offer various beauty-benefiting effects. This spring, incorporate nature’s wonders into your clients' beauty regimens with our beauty picks, and see why flowers don’t just make for pretty centerpieces.
FACE

Formulated with Swiss Alpine Rose Stem Cells, AHA and Mushroom Extract, Dermelect Cosmeceuticals Resilient Stem Cell Regenerating Treatment increases the skin cell vitality, elasticity and softness. The skin-perfecting creams also boosts regeneration and reverses damage by free radical agents to leave the skin with a radiant spring glow, and a visible decrease in the appearance of wrinkles. Provide double-duty beauty to your clients' cheeks with glÅ minerals Powder Cheek Stain, a universal stain with long-lasting, all day power in an easy application of a powder blush. Safflower Seed Oil and Honeysuckle Flower Extract hydrate and soften the skin, leaving a vibrant rosy flush perfect for the upcoming season that flatters all skin tones. Palladio Beauty Revitalizing Night Repair Cream, an intensely hydrating treatment, firms the skin and visibly reduces uneven, rough texture to reveal an envy-inducing radiance. Formulated with Sunflower Oil to provide calming and moisturizing properties, antioxidant Pomegranate Extract helps promote cell regeneration, Vitamin E reduces the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les, and Triglycerides condition and nourish the skin. BODY

Slather on glÅ therapeutics Cyto-luxe Body Lotion, a moisturizer that employs powerful peptides and antioxidants to protect, tone and nurture thirsty and mature skin. This deeply nourishing lotion features Evening Primrose Oil and Lavender to rejuvenate tired, aging and dry skin while Syn-Coll Peptide penetrates deeply to help promote collagen production, reducing the appearance of wrinkles, and Shea Butter assists in smoothing skin and reducing irritation, dryness, dermatitis, eczema and other skin conditions. HAIR

Deliver a healthy, gorgeous shine using Keratin Complex KeraWhip Hydrating Cream Conditioner, a unique air-like whipped texture packaged in an easy to use “whipped cream” dispenser. A blend of conditioners including Safflower Oil and Coconut increase manageability, deliver intense hydration needed in warmer temperatures and help control breakage and split ends without weighing hair down.
